Skip to main content

state Namespace

Definition

namespace helios::engine::state { ... }

Namespaces Index

namespacecommands
namespacecomponents
namespacelisteners
namespacetypes

Classes Index

classCombinedStateToIdMapPair<LState, RState, TId>

Maps combined state pairs directly to ID lists. More...

classStateCommandHandler

Abstract base for type-erased state command handling. More...

classStateManager<StateType>

Manages state transitions using a rule-based system. More...

classStateToIdMap<TState, TId>

Maps state enum values to lists of IDs. More...

classStateToIdMapPair<LState, RState, TId>

Combines two StateToIdMap instances for dual-state lookups. More...

classStateTransitionListener<StateType>

Interface for observing state transitions. More...

classTypedStateCommandHandler<StateType>

Typed interface for handling state commands. More...


Generated via doxygen2docusaurus 2.0.0 by Doxygen 1.9.8.